X is a high scoring tile worth a whopping 8 points in both Scrabble and Words with Friends. Thus, it can quickly increase your game score if used strategically.   Here are some ideas to use &#8220;x&#8221; in Scrabble that just might help you\u2026<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Use &#8220;x&#8221; to create a hook<\/strong><\/h4>\n\n\n\n<p>Spell out a word by hooking onto either A E I O or U. You can do that by memorizing the 2 letter words that include X.  So for example if you see an I on the board that is free, you can spell out FLEX and have the X intersect with I, so that you earn points for both FLEX and XI. Throw out the word Oxyphenbutazone on the board. Yes, that\u2019s a real word. No, it won&#8217;t be easy to play, probably ever. So may you can at least to tell people about it!  Oxyphenbutazone is defined as a non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ug. Just placing this word on the board will score you a minimum of 41 points. However, if played right, placing it across three triple-word-score squares and joining seven tiles to eight already-played tiles, it could score you 1,780 points! In fact, this word is theoretically the highest possible scoring word in Scrabble.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Here are some more words you could play: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\"><li>Score 21 points with the word jinx!!<\/li><li>Get a whopping 30 points with the word Exoenzyme (an enzyme that is secreted by a cell and acts outside of that cell).<\/li><li>If you do find yourself with an X, save it for a double or triple point and get the bang for your buck.<\/li><li>Take the easy way out by playing the word XI for a total of 9 points!<\/li><li>Ever heard of the word Quixotry??
